Where does the furniture come from?
All of our furniture is built in Ohio, primarily in Wayne and Holmes Counties, home of the largest population of Amish in the world.  We use over 100 Amish Craftsman who use time-tested techniques to build quality wood furniture.  Some of these craftsman specialize in specific items.....like chairs or tables or beds.  Others focus their time on building Custom pieces.  Over the years, we feel we have identified the "best of the best" in each area and will interface with them to produce exactly what you want in your furniture.
The furniture industry in this part of Ohio is well developed, starting with the wood stock, which is harvested in Ohio and surrounding states.  The sawmills located here find and process only the finest Oak, Cherry, Maple, and Hickory wood to make heirloom quality furniture.
How do I get started?  How does it work building custom furniture?
While it may sound overwhelming, it really is pretty easy.  Here's the questions you need to answer....with our help:
  1. What are the dimensions of the area that you are looking at?  Think through the size that you need now or may need down the road.....remember this furniture will last.  Do you need a table that seats 6......or maybe 10?  Do you need a twin bed or a king?
  2. What type of wood do you want?  Oak is still the most popular choice, but we are building more and more furniture in Cherry, Quarter Sawn Oak, and Brown Maple.  We can help you work through this with our experience in the different types of wood.

What color do you want the wood?  Included in your price is the staining of your furniture to the color that you would like.  We use Ohio Certified Stains and have stain boards in all of our stores to give you visual representations of the colors on the specific wood that you want.  For additional charges, we will also use specialty finishes and paint to give you a unique look for your home.
  4. What style furniture do you want?  Look through the web site to start....you'll see Mission, Shaker, Queen Anne, Country....and everything in between.

What's there to do in Kidron?
Kidron is a unique small village in the heart of Amish Country in Wayne County, Ohio.  Kidron is well known in these parts for their auction facilities which includes livestock (every Thursday) and equipment and machinery auctions.
